FTP won't work properly

I am running Linkstation duo 2TB with firmware 1.64.

 

I have activated FTP on all shared folder and set up access restrictions so that I have to log in using username and password.

 

I can access the FTP from within my own home network, using the IP 192.168.0.198 where it asks for username and password. Both users I have created works fine.

 

I have then forwarded port 21 in my router and using this: http://www.canyouseeme.org/">http://www.canyouseeme.org/ I have confirmed that my port is forwarded correctly. I have also forwarded ports to my game server this way and the servers that is running runs just fine.

 

So when I go online (from within the house that is) using IP 91.150.233.81 which is my public IP it just won't show the files and folders. It seems to connect fine but I get an error:

"200 type set to A" and

"227 entering passive mode (192,168,0,198,160,54)"

 

I have had an FTP server set up on my game server too, and that works just fine if I try to access it via my public IP, this only happens with the linkstation.

I have tried both FileZilla FTP client and Windows Explorer, both give the same error.

 

What can I do?
